XCL are offering NEW Trainee Recruitment positions in their well established Huddersfield office.
As a Trainee Recruitment consultant, you will be trained in all aspects of recruitment either on Temporary desk or permanent desk.
A Recruitment Consultant will be responsible for:
- Generating new sales and leads.
- Following up all potential sales leads.
- Liaising with new and existing clients.
- Interviewing and registering new candidates.
- Sourcing candidates for current and future vacancies.
- Building strong candidate relationships.
- Conducting reference calls.
- Updating our CRM system on a regular basis.
- Compliance and industry knowledge.
We will take you through the stages of developing into a successful Consultant with the opportunity of progressing in your career.
The successful candidates will be able to demonstrate:
- A genuine desire to learn the skills required in the role.
- Excellent work ethic with an enthusiastic attitude.
- A flair in sales.
- Have good telephone skills.
- IT literate and the ability to pick up and learn new information.
- Some work experience within a customer service environment.
The sucessfull candidate must have a driving licence as this role when trained will involve company visits.
